Why Every Woman’s Menopause Experience Is Different
Ask a group of women about their menopause experiences and you will hear a remarkable range of stories. One woman barely noticed the transition. Another found it one of the most challenging periods of her life. One had severe hot flushes for years; another never had them at all. One felt emotionally steady throughout; another found her mental health significantly affected.
These differences are not a matter of individual weakness or resilience. They reflect the complex interplay of biology, lifestyle, psychology, and culture that shapes each woman’s unique experience. Understanding why symptom variability exists, and what drives it, helps women avoid comparing themselves unfairly to others and gives them a more accurate picture of what to expect from their own transition. This article explores the key factors that determine how menopause is experienced.
The Same Hormonal Shift, Different Experiences
All women going through natural menopause experience a decline in oestrogen and progesterone. The hormonal change is universal. But the way that change is experienced is not, and researchers have been working to understand why.
One part of the answer lies in the rate and pattern of hormonal decline. Women whose oestrogen levels fluctuate more dramatically during perimenopause tend to report more intense vasomotor symptoms, such as hot flushes and night sweats, than women whose levels decline more gradually. This rate of decline is influenced by genetics and cannot be directly controlled, but it helps explain why two women with similar lifestyles and health backgrounds can have very different symptom burdens.
Individual sensitivity to hormonal change also plays a role. The brain and body’s response to falling oestrogen is not identical across women. Some women’s temperature regulation centres appear more sensitive to oestrogen fluctuations, producing more frequent and intense hot flushes. Others seem to tolerate the same degree of hormonal change with fewer symptoms. The biological mechanisms behind this sensitivity are still being studied.
How Genetics, Body Composition, and Health History Shape the Experience
Genetics influences not just the timing of menopause, as discussed in the previous article, but also the nature of the experience. Women whose mothers or sisters had particularly symptomatic transitions are more likely to report similar experiences themselves, suggesting a heritable component to symptom burden.
Body composition is another factor. Body fat produces oestrone, a weaker form of oestrogen, through a process called peripheral conversion. Women with higher body fat carry a larger reserve of this additional oestrogen, which may buffer some of the hormonal decline and reduce the severity of certain symptoms. However, this relationship is not straightforward: higher body weight is also associated with more severe hot flushes in some studies, possibly because body fat acts as insulation and makes temperature regulation more difficult. The relationship between body composition and menopause symptoms is genuinely complex, and generalisations should be made with caution.
Reproductive and health history also shapes experience. Women who have experienced significant premenstrual symptoms across their reproductive years are more likely to report mood-related symptoms during the menopausal transition, suggesting an underlying sensitivity to hormonal fluctuation that persists across life stages. Thyroid conditions, diabetes, and cardiovascular health all interact with the hormonal environment of menopause in ways that can amplify or modify symptoms.
Lifestyle Factors That Influence Symptom Severity
Several lifestyle factors have a meaningful association with symptom variability. Physical activity is one of the most consistently supported: women who exercise regularly tend to report milder vasomotor symptoms and better sleep during the transition, possibly due to the effect of exercise on thermoregulation, mood, and overall hormonal balance.
Diet also plays a role. Emerging research, though not yet definitive, suggests that diets higher in phytoestrogens (plant compounds that weakly mimic oestrogen, found in foods like soy, flaxseeds, and legumes) may be associated with milder vasomotor symptoms in some populations. Given that soy and legumes are staples in many Indian diets, this is a potentially relevant consideration for Indian women, though more research specific to this population is needed.
Smoking is consistently associated with more severe hot flushes, in addition to its known effect on earlier menopause timing. High stress levels, poor sleep, and excessive alcohol consumption are also linked to more disruptive symptom patterns, though causality is complex since these factors both influence and are influenced by the menopause experience itself.
Did You Know? A large study called the Study of Women’s Health Across the Nation (SWAN), which followed women from multiple ethnic backgrounds over many years, found significant differences in vasomotor symptom rates between groups. African American women reported the highest rates; Japanese and Chinese women reported among the lowest. These findings suggest that ethnicity, culture, and possibly diet all contribute to how menopause is experienced.
The Role of Stress, Mental Health, and Social Context
Psychological and social factors have a real and measurable influence on menopause symptom severity. Women experiencing high levels of life stress, whether from caregiving responsibilities, relationship difficulties, work pressure, or financial concerns, consistently report more severe and disruptive symptoms. This is not a sign of emotional weakness. Stress activates physiological pathways that amplify the body’s sensitivity to hormonal fluctuation.
Mental health history also matters. Women with a prior history of anxiety or depression are at higher risk of experiencing mood-related symptoms during the menopausal transition. This does not mean that menopause will inevitably worsen mental health for these women, but it does mean that awareness and proactive support are particularly valuable.
Social context shapes experience in subtler ways too. Research suggests that cultural attitudes towards menopause influence how women perceive and report their symptoms. In communities where menopause is associated with loss or ageing, women may find the transition more distressing. In communities where it is viewed as a natural and even positive life change, women tend to report less difficulty. This is not about positive thinking overriding biology; it reflects the genuine influence of meaning-making on physical experience.
For Indian women, navigating menopause within a social context that rarely names or discusses it openly can add an extra layer of difficulty. Symptoms that go unrecognised and unspoken are harder to seek help for, and isolation in the experience can amplify its impact.
Key Takeaways
- All women experience the same underlying hormonal shift at menopause, but the rate of decline, individual hormonal sensitivity, genetics, and body composition produce widely different symptom experiences.
- Lifestyle factors including physical activity, diet, smoking, and stress levels have a meaningful influence on symptom severity and can be modified.
- Psychological history, particularly prior anxiety or depression, is associated with a greater likelihood of mood-related symptoms during the transition.
- Cultural attitudes and social context genuinely shape how menopause is experienced, beyond just how it is reported.
- Comparing your experience to another woman’s is rarely helpful; variability is the norm, not the exception.
